plague Definition
(n)
a
serious
(
sometimes
fatal
)
infection
of
rodents
caused
by
Yersinia
pestis
and
accidentally
transmitted
to
humans
by
the
bite
of
an
infected
rat
flea
(
especially
bubonic
plague
)
(n)
any
epidemic
disease
with
a
high
death
rate
(n)
a
swarm
of
insects
that
attack
plants
; "
a
plague
of
grasshoppers
"
(n)
any
large
scale
calamity
(
especially
when
thought
to
be
sent
by
God
)
(n)
an
annoyance
; "
those
children
are
a
damn
plague
"
(v)
cause
to
suffer
a
blight
; "
Too
much
rain
may
blight
the
garden
with
mold
"
(v)
annoy
continually
or
chronically
; "
He
is
known
to
harry
his
staff
when
he
is
overworked
"; "
This
man
harasses
his
female
co
-
workers
"
